The purpose of this Sources Sought Notice is to collect information of qualified contractors as part of a market research conducted by NAVFAC Far East FEAD Okinawa for support Environmental service contract, including Hazardous Waste (HW) collection, documentation and transportation to, and management and operation of Hazardous Waste Storage Areas (HWSAs) at U.S. Marine Corps Base, Camp Kinser (Camp Kinser), for Commander, Fleet Activities Okinawa (CFAO), Japan.

The Government invites contractors with the capabilities necessary to meet or exceed the stated requirements to submit Capability Statements consisting of appropriate documentation, literature, brochures, and references.  The Capabilities Statement for this sources sought is not expected to be a proposal, but rather short statements regarding the company’s ability to demonstrate existing-or-developed expertise and experience in relation to the areas specified herein.

The North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) Code is 562910 – Remediation Services

Performance Period: 12 months.

Work Requirements:

The contract shall provide all necessary labor, materials, equipment, supervision, supplies, transportation, and incidentals to perform the services for Hazardous Waste (HW) collection, documentation and transportation to, and management and operation of Hazardous Waste Storage Areas (HWSAs) at U.S. Marine Corps Base, Camp Kinser (Camp Kinser), for Commander, Fleet Activities Okinawa (CFAO), Japan.
